  • About Edmunds
    Our Web sites consist of Edmunds.com (launched in 1995 as the first automotive information Web site), Inside Line (launched in 2005 and the most-read automotive enthusiast Web site), CarSpace (launched in 2006 as our automotive social networking site), AutoObserver.com (launched in 2007 to provide insightful automotive industry commentary and analysis) and Green Car Advisor (launched in 2007 to provide news and commentary on environmental automotive trends and technologies). Edmunds.com was named "Best Car Research Site" by Forbes ASAP, has been selected by consumers as the "Most Useful Web Site" according to every J.D. Power and Associates New Autoshopper.com Study(SM), was ranked first in the Survey of Car-Shopping Web Sites by The Wall Street Journal and was rated "#1" in Keynote's study of third-party automotive Web sites. Edmunds Inc. is headquartered in Santa Monica, California, and we maintain a satellite office in suburban Detroit.
